2. Solo Gains Momentum – Women in their 50s and older, in particular, are traveling alone to see the world. According to OAT, the number of solo travelers booking in 2023 will increase by 24% compared to 2019. Overall, more than 60% of her OAT travelers are solo travelers and the majority are women.

PERSONALIZED TRAVEL – Travelers are seeking the benefits of small-group tours led by experts, but increasingly want more than a one-size-fits-all experience. 2023 will see continued demand from travelers to tailor their trips to individual preferences. For example, many travelers prefer to arrive early at their destination before the tour starts so they can acclimate.
On OAT, 87% of travelers personalize their trip by arriving early, staying late, adding stopovers in popular international cities, or combining trips. By comparison, only 75% requested personalization in 2018.
4. Regenerative running – The idea that tourism should leave destinations better than they used to is taking hold globally. In a nutshell, regenerative tourism improves local economies while preserving local culture and biodiversity. You can benefit locals and improve destinations while providing authentic experiences for travelers.
OAT, through the Grand Circle Foundation, We support projects focused on water, conservation and renewable energy in the regions where the company travels. Water, Sanitation, Hygiene (WASH) initiatives help improve the well-being of local people. Access to safe water, adequate sanitation and good hygiene education reduces morbidity and mortality and promotes socioeconomic development that reduces poverty. The Foundation supports alternative energy sources to reduce carbon emissions and dependence on fossil fuels. Some schools are adding solar panels as an alternative power source to reduce operating costs. The Foundation’s solar lights will replace kerosene, reduce illnesses caused by soot and smoke, and enable students to study at night, leading to better education.

About overseas adventure travel
Founded in 1978, Overseas Adventure Travel (OAT) is part of the Boston-based Grand Circle Corporation travel agency family, which also includes Grand Circle Cruise Lines and Grand Circle Travel. In 1992, owners Alan Lewis and Harriet Lewis founded the non-profit Grand Circle Foundation to support the communities in which Grand Circle works and travels. This includes around 300 humanitarian, cultural and educational initiatives around the world. Among them are 100 schools in 50 countries. The Foundation is an entity of the Alnoba Lewis Family Foundation that has pledged or contributed over $250 million since 1981.
